Efficiency, Feasibility, and Incentive-Awareness in Constrained Online Resource Allocation

Read the original on arXiv Machine Learning →

arXiv:2507. 09473v2 Announce Type: replace-cross Abstract: We study the dynamic allocation of indivisible resources to strategic agents under long-term constraints, where the planner aims to maximize social welfare, satisfy multiple constraints, and elicit near-truthful reports.
